WebThe Mid-Year Convention treats forecasted free cash flows (FCFs) as if they were generated at the midpoint of the period. Web5 nov. 2014 · Most churches use the traditional calendar year—January 1 to December 31—for their budget years. But not all churches do. Some use a fiscal year—often July 1 to June 30—and those that do say it helps ease the administrative burdens that come in December and January.
